Dancing Feet! by Lindsey Craig
Clickity!Clickity! Long green feet!
Who is dancing that clickity beat?
Lizard is dancing on clickity feet.
Clickity! Clickity! Happy feet!
Introducing a get-up-and-dance toddler book-so catchy and rhythmic, you'll almost want to sing it.
Lindsey Craig's rollicking text features funny sound words (Tippity! Creepity! Stompity! Thumpity!), dancing animals, a singsong beat, and a guessing element just easy enough for preschoolers to anticipate. Marc Brown's artwork is bright, textured, and joyful, a collage of simple shapes for kids to find and name.
So grab a partner and tap your feet to this read-aloud picture-book treat.
Lindsey Craig was born into a family of singers and dancers. She often perceives music in mundane things, from blaring vehicles to thrumming crickets, when she wakes up tapping her foot. Her children's play, Cinderella's Shakespeare, is played all across the country, and she has created a musical. Feet that dance! She lives on a small island in Washington State with her husband and children.
Marc Brown is the creator of Arthur, the star of numerous picture books and a PBS television show that has won six Emmy Awards. He also illustrated Laura Joy Rennert's Purchasing, Training, and Caring for Your Dinosaur, as well as Judy Sierra's New York Times bestsellers Crazy About Books and Born to Read. He splits his time between Martha's Vineyard and New York City.
